asp.net办公自动化系统OA论文.doc
PAGE
PAGEI
摘要
随着信息化建设的日益深入,无论是单位公司,还是学校,各个部门之间的信息沟通与协调工作越来越重要。人们迫切需要一个能充分利用网络优势,并可以管理学校或者学校的各种重要信息,以及日常行为的软件平台,利用该平台快速建立自己的信息网络和办公管理系统。基于以上的原因,办公自动化系统应运而生。办公自动化系统简称称为OA系统,英文名为officeautomatizationsystem.它充分的利用计算机技术和网络技术,使办公室部分工作逐步信息化,从而形成由办公室人员与办公设备共同构成服务于某种目标的人机信息处理系统。随着网络的发展,办公自动化系统已经成为办公信息化管理的一个重要途径。
在深刻了解OA系统发展的背景和国内外的发展现状后,通过进行可行性研究,大量的市场调研,和需求的分析,我明确了开发这样一套管理系统的方向和价值。所以我决定开发一款办公自动化系统,为我们学校的日常办公提供优质的服务。本办公自动化系统采用ASP.NET(C#)作为开发工具。采用SQLSERVER2005开发后台数据库。在页面的设计上,我们采用dreamweaver进行前期的原型设计,然后在原型的基础上面进行详细设计以及数据库的设计。在数据库的设计上面,根据系统的需要,设计了管理员表,公务信息表,公务收藏表,会议信息表,机构信息表,日程信息表,通讯录表,用户信息表,新闻信息表。整体的设计思路上面,整个系统划分为个人事务管理、办公事务管理、系统管理三大模块。系统用户能够通过这些模块所提供的功能,完成相关的数据库的操作,最终完成对学校各种日常办公的管理。
关键词:ASP.NETSQLServer2005数据库
Abstract
Withtheconstructionofinformationincreasinglydeepening,regardlessofUnitcompany,orschool,betweeneachdepartmentofinformationcommunicationandcoordinationworkisbecomingincreasinglyimportant.Therewasanurgentneedtomakefulluseoftheadvantageofnetwork,allkindsofimportantinformationandcanmanageorschool,anddailybehaviorofthesoftwareplatform,usetobuildtheirowninformationnetworkandofficemanagementsystemfortheplatform.Basedontheabovereasons,emergeasthetimesrequiretheofficeautomationsystem.OfficeautomationsystemasasystemcalledOA,Englishnameisofficeautomatizationsystem.itistheuseofcomputertechnologyandnetworktechnologyfully,sothatapartofofficeworkstepbystepinformation,therebyformingahumaninformationprocessingsystembytheofficepersonnelandofficeequipmentconstitutesaservicetoacommongoal.Withthedevelopmentofnetwork,officeautomationsystemhasbecomeanimportantwaytotheofficeinformationmanagement.
OAprofoundunderstandingofthesystemsdevelopmentbackgroundandthedomesticandforeigndevelopmentstatus,throughthefeasibilitystudy,alargenumberofmarketresearch,analysisanddemand,Idefinedthedi